Generally, employers may receive a credit of 5.4 when they file their Form 940, Employer’s Annual Federal Unemployment (FUTA) Tax Return, to result in a net FUTA tax rate of 0.6 (6.0 - 5.4 0.6). Form 940, also known as the Employers Annual Federal Unemployment (FUTA) Tax Return, is an IRS tax form that employers must file annually to report wages paid to employees.
